What is the USPS Postal Exam 474–477?

The USPS Postal Exam 474–477 is a virtual assessment designed to evaluate a candidate's suitability for various operational roles within the postal service. Unlike traditional academic tests, these exams focus on your behavioral tendencies, work-related decision-making, and ability to handle the specific demands of postal work environments.

By focusing on core competencies like situational judgment, memory retention, and attention to detail, the USPS ensures that new hires are prepared for the fast-paced nature of mail delivery and processing. Who Should Take This Exam?

This exam is required for anyone applying for essential frontline roles, including City Carrier Assistant, Mail Handler Assistant, Postal Support Employee, and Mail Processing Clerk. Whether you are a first-time applicant or looking to transition into a new career, meeting the eligibility requirements and passing this assessment is a mandatory milestone.
